Give me the flow of the Fd fans

A
  • Takes suction from the atmosphere through a wire mesh preventing plastics and debris then goes to the outlet damper- secondary air heaters- venturi- secondary control dampers x 8 ( 2 at 10.7 ladder and 2 behind venturi on each side)then to windbox - furnace

Give me the standby of the ID Fans

A

Standby

  • Drain valves closed
  • Vane air piston on minimum limit postion
  • Fan shaft not rotating
  • Motorized inlet damper is closed on remote
  • Guilotine damper remote and closed
  • Guiltine damper is on the top physically
  • Fan manhole closed
  • All stop buttons of cooling air fan and ID fan released ( 2 and 1)
  • Motor and fan bearing vibrations reset
  • Motor bearing oil level is 75%
  • Lube oil system tank oil level is 75%

What are some of the issues of the lube oil system ?
Oil leak on system - bearings damaged - Report to panel Oil temp high - Cooling air fan on, filter IC and heater switched off Low level resovior/ low low - call for top up - Report to spc Diffirential pressure high - change filters Low pressure - Check set point 150 kpa - Check isolating valve is open Bonus: Check inlet and outlet valve is open
